if


* if 与 else 语句:

LPC 的 if 语句与 C 提供的相同. 语法如下:

第二种语法: 第三种: 第四种: else if 子句没有什么数量上的限制.


另一个好用的程序结构是 ? : 运算符. 它与 C 提供的一样. 语法如下:

    运算式一 ? 运算式一为则进行运算式二 : 运算式一为则进行运算式三

某些情形下, ? : 算是以下程序结构的缩写:

    if (运算式一)
        变量 = 运算式二;
    else
        变量 = 运算式三;

上面这段程序可以转换成下面这行:

    变量 = 运算式一 ? 运算式二 : 运算式三;


翻译: Spock @ FF 97.Aug.9.

回到上一页